    Negril, late 1970's, there used to be a thatched roof round bar / restaurant called Cosmo's by the soccer field (football pitch) almost as far down from town as Rutland Point. After walking or jogging the beach it was awesome to get a cold Red Stripe and a bowl of spicy Conch Soup and a coco bread. The Conch Soup was the best. So spicy it would take 2 or 3 beers to cool it down. Is Cosmo's still around???
    Yes, Cosmo's is definitely still around, well built up and going strong.

    My current favourite soups around town...Cosmo's red pea with pigs tail (they will warn you about the pigs tail if you're not Jamaican )...Omar's newer restaurant next to Drifter's Bar has incredible pumpkin and chicken soup (fresh made without the additional cock soup packet that has msg)...Bar Negril with whatever Tony has on that day.
